Best time to go to Huntly

The best time to visit Huntly can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Huntly fal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Huntly fal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Huntly

Getting to Huntly, Scotland, is convenient with nearby airports such as Aberdeen (ABZ) and INVerness (INV). Aberdeen Airport is situated 45.1km from Huntly, with notable hotels like the 5-star Marcliffe and Leonardo Hotel, both 9.7km away, offering easy access. Inverness Airport, located 77.2km away, features luxurious options like the 5-star Ness Walk and Rocpool Reserve, both 12.9km from the airport. Dundee Airport, 111.0km from Huntly, has excellent accommodations including The Hideaway Experience, 8.0km away, and Apex City Quay Hotel & Spa, just 4.8km distant, ensuring a comfortable stay while exploring the area.

What's the seasonal weather in Huntly?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Huntly is 876 mm.
